## Pricing Experiment: Project Copperfare

Quick context for the sync: we're A/B testing dynamic ticket prices on the Brindlehop events app. Flag is `COPPERFARE_DYNAMIC_PRICING`, rollout at 10%. Variant assignment happens in the gateway, so don't cache prices client-side. The experiment service also needs its API secret, added on the line right below.

vault entry, fafop-badup: VAULT_KEY5=2cf8b

**Minutes — Management Meeting, Retirement of the Ostrel Line**

Present: Dana Krivell (chair), Tomas Reyburn, Ilsa Farrow.

The group confirmed the phased retirement of the Ostrel product line. Manufacturing at the Pellwick plant ends next quarter; spare-parts support continues for eighteen months. Tomas will draft customer notices; Ilsa will manage reseller transitions. Remaining inventory will be discounted through approved channels only. For the incoming director, the forward plan that this retirement enables is recorded below.

confidential, kagup-bafog: Fraaxax Group is in early talks to buy Soroxox Group for about $343.8 million. The Olidor launch date is June 14, and nothing goes to the press before then. Legal wants the Aldmirek Logistics term sheet signed before July 23.

## v3.8.2 — Connection Pooling Rework

Swapped the old per-request connection setup in Burrowbase for a proper pool via the Tapline library. Idle connections now get recycled after five minutes, and credentials are fetched once at pool init instead of per checkout — worth a look from a security angle. Pool size caps are configurable but default to 20. No schema changes, no downtime expected. The engineer who owns this change and its review is named below.

account owner for bawip-tahag: Raleth Quenok

# Chronomark Environments

Summary for the weekly sync: cron drift on the staging scheduler traced to a stale timezone bundle baked into the Chronomark image. Prod and staging now build from the same base; dev still lags one release. Drift is under 200ms after the fix. Tolen owns the follow-up audit. The staging environment runs with the values below.

deployment values, bahof-kafog:
FENAEL_LOG_LEVEL=warn
FENAEL_METRICS_HOST=metrics.fenael.qorvellabs.corp
FENAEL_POOL_SIZE=16